Bishopstone (Sussex) station may not feature the grandiosity of some major stations, yet it offers essential services to ensure a smooth start to your journey. While there is no ticket office, ticket machines are available for you to easily collect tickets purchased online. These machines are designed to be accessible, supporting disc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ders.
Access support is well-founded, even if the station itself has limitations. With no step-free access, careful planning is recommended. The station provides an "Assistance Meeting Point" and offers staff-operated ramps for train access. It's worth booking help in advance, although you can press the "emergency & assisted travel" button on platform Help Points for immediate support.
Despite its modest size, Bishopstone (Sussex) holds strong connections to various modes of transport. Public buses are a viable option for further travel, as indicated on the ‘Onward Travel Information Map’. Although Bishopstone (Sussex) doesn’t facilitate car hires or taxis directly onsite, arranging these services in advance can help ease your transition to nearby regions.

Shirley Train Station offers a range of essential facilities to make your journey comfortable. The ticket office is open from Monday to Friday, 6:30 am to 12:00 pm, with extended hours until 8:00 pm on Fridays and Saturdays. While ticket machines are available for ease, the station lacks accessible ticket machines. However, rest assured you can collect tickets conveniently from the office.
Accessible features at Shirley include step-free access to all platforms, making it a category A station for accessibility. Though there are no waiting rooms, there is a seating area and available toilets on Platform 1. These include accessible toilets operated by a RADAR key, obtainable from station staff during their hours.
Travelling beyond Shirley is simple with several onward travel options. Should rail replacement services be necessary, they depart from the station entrance. For those preferring taxis, local services like Shirley (SRL) Station A to B, Senator, and Able are available for hire. Additionally, the station is well-connected by buses, allowing easy exploration of the surrounding area.
